About the roleand about you
We're looking for a
Customer Care Hub Consultant
to join our Customers team on a contract to April **** for a parental leave contract cover, to deliver high‐quality, customer‐centred service to our tenants and stakeholders.
As a key member of our Customer Care Hub, you'll be the first point of contact for customers, handling inbound enquiries related to repairs, maintenance, tenancy matters and general support. You'll work in a fast‐paced, high‐volume environment where professionalism, empathy and problem‐solving are essential. The duties in this role include but are not limited to:
Deliver responsive, respectful and professional customer service via inbound calls
Accurately log and manage customer enquiries and records
Respond to tenancy‐related enquiries and support early intervention strategies
Provide clear information about SGCH services and support options
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to resolve complex enquiries
Exercise delegated authority in line with SGCH policies and procedures
Contribute to a positive, inclusive and safety‐focused workplace culture
